DATA ENTRY CLERKS (BIOTECHNOLOGY: CLINICAL RESEARCH) California Occupational Guide Number 2007 (part) Interest Area: Emerging Occupations 1996
Data Entry Clerks are responsible for using a keyboard or other type of data entry device to enter clinical research data into a computer statistical database. They may operate on-line terminals, personal computers, and scanners.
$11,000 - $25,000 per year
Skills/Knowledge Ability to key enter data at a high speed and with accuracy. Good spelling and grammatical skills. Familiarity with technical language and terminology. Training/Requirements High school diploma or AA degree with training in word processing, data entry or some job experience.
DOT: Data Entry Clerk, 203.582-054 OES: Data Entry Keyers, 560170
